A N A C T
RELATING TO FOOD AND DRUGS -- SANITATION IN FOOD ESTABLISHMENTS
Introduced By: Senators P Fogarty, and Gallo
Date Introduced: May 14, 2009
It is enacted by the
General Assembly as follows:
SECTION 1. Section 21-27-1 of the General Laws in Chapter
21-27 entitled "Sanitation
in Food Establishments" is hereby amended to read
as follows:
21-27-1.
Definitions. -- Unless otherwise specifically
provided in this chapter, the
following definitions apply to this chapter:
(1)
"Approved" means approved by the director.
(2)
"Commissary" means a central processing establishment where food is
prepared for
sale or service off the premises or by mobile vendor.
(3)
"Department" means the department of health.
(4)
"Director" means the director of health or the director's duly
appointed agents.
(5) "Farmers
market" means a market where two (2) or more farmers are selling produce
exclusively grown on their own farms on a retail basis to
consumers. Excluded from this term is
any market where farmers or others are selling produce at
wholesale and/or any market in which
any individual is selling produce not grown on his or her
own farm.
(6) "Farm home
food manufacture" means the production in accordance with the
requirements of section 21-27-6.1 of food for retail sale in a
residential kitchen on a farm which
produces agricultural products for human consumption and the
operator of which is eligible for
exemption from the sales and use tax in accordance with section
44-18-30(32).
(7) "Food"
means: (i) articles used for food or drink for people
or other animals, (ii)
chewing gum, and (iii) articles used for components of any
food or drink article.
(8) "Food
business" means and includes any establishment or place, whether fixed or
mobile, where food or ice is held, processed, manufactured,
packaged, prepared, displayed,
served, transported, or sold.
(9) "Food service
establishment" means any fixed or mobile restaurant, coffee shop,
cafeteria, short-order cafe, luncheonette, grill, tearoom,
sandwich shop, soda fountain, tavern; bar,
cocktail lounge, night club, roadside stand, industrial
feeding establishment, cultural heritage
education facility, private, public or nonprofit organization
or institution routinely serving food,
catering kitchen, commissary or similar place in which food or
drink is prepared for sale or for
service on the premises or elsewhere, and any other eating or
drinking establishment or operation
where food is served or provided for the public with or
without charge.
(10) "Mobile food
service unit" means a unit that prepares and/or sells food products for
direct consumption.
(11) "Person"
means any individual, firm, co-partnership, association, or private or
municipal corporation.
(12)
"Processor" means one who combines, handles, manufactures or
prepares, packages,
and stores food products.
(13)
"Operator" in relation to food vending machines means any person who
by contract,
agreement, lease, rental, or ownership sells food from vending machines.
(14) "Retail"
means when eighty percent (80%) or more of sales are made directly to
consumers.
(15) "Retail
peddler" means a food business which sells meat, seafood, and dairy
products directly to the consumer, house to house or in a
neighborhood.
(16) "Roadside farmstand" means a stand or location adjacent to a
farm where produce
grown only on that farm is sold at the time of harvest.
(17) "Vending
machine site or location" means the room, enclosure, space, or area where
one or more vending machines are installed and/or
operated.
(18)
"Warehouse" means a place for the storage of dried, fresh, or frozen
food or food
products, not including those areas associated within or
directly part of a food service
establishment or retail market.
(19)
"Wholesale" means when eighty percent (80%) or more of the business
is for resale
purposes.
(20) "Cultural
heritage education facility" means a facility for up to ten (10)
individuals
who, for a fee, participate in the preparation and
consumption of food, limited to an owner-
occupied site which is "listed" on the state or
federal historic register documented to be at least
one hundred fifty (150) years old and whose drinking water shall be obtained from an
approved
source which meets all of the requirements of chapter 46-13.
SECTION 2. This act shall take effect upon passage.
